Bigach (from {{langx|kk|қиғаш}}, Qiğaş – curved) is an impact crater in Kazakhstan.{{Cite Earth Impact DB | name = Bigach | accessdate = 2008-12-30 }}
It is 8 km in diameter and the age is estimated to be 5 ± 3 million years (Pliocene or Miocene). The crater is exposed at the surface.
